Job lock faied - what does it mean?

I’m still floundering. New install of satnogs-client on RPi. Can’t get off the ground. Where should I start? My observations are all black(failed). First is typical from journalctl:

Feb 3 22:32:31 satnogs190 satnogs-client[324]: satnogsclient.scheduler.tasks - ERROR - Observer job lock acquiring timed out.

Please share your config and log information, now it is a needle in a haystack.

  • sudo satnogs-setup -> Advanced -> Support
  • sudo journalctl -f -u satnogs-client -n 512

satnogs_soapy_rx_device": “rtlsdr” change this to satnogs_soapy_rx_device": “driver=rtlsdr”

We see some network connect errors, can you try ping network.satnogs.org and see if we get a ping reply.

I guess the main issue is the missing driver= value.
